Biographical History
Elva J. Jensen was born and raised in Centerville and Gunnison, Utah. She attended school at Snow College in Ephraim, Utah. She married Mardell Jensen before he was drafted into the U.S. Marines to serve in the Korean War. While he was in Korea, she worked as a secretary at Gunnison Sugar Valley Sales. She kept track of the books and sold parts. When he returned, they adopted one child and had three more. They had a long, happy marriage. She passed away on May 27, 2021.
